System requirements: 25 MB of free hard drive space.
You must use the Wyoming Grasshopper Information System, WGIS, setup program to install
the program. The files cannot be copied onto your hard drive because the files are
compressed on the setup disks.
Setup will allow you to pick the directory or folder you would like the program in.
Installing the program on Windows 3.1 or Windows NT™ 3.51
To Run the program
After the program has been installed Double-click on the group in the Windows Program manager named "WGIS" and then Double-click on the WGIS icon to start the program.
Installing the program on Windows 95 or Windows NT™ 4.0
To Run the program
After the program has been installed click on the Start button, click Programs, click Wyoming Grasshopper Information System folder, and then the WGIS, icon.
